M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ge (2015).
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.
Learn more about the book MOOCs and Open Education
MOOCs and Open Education is a
edited collection
which
reviews
topics
having to do with open
education resources
(OERs) and
massive open online courses.
The latest
gains in
online education technology have enabled
people
in all parts of the world
to take classes via the Internet.
MOOC courses are
commonly free
for students but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
